
آیا همیشه آرزو داشتید وبسایت شخصی خودتان را بسازید؟ یا شاید هم میخواهید یک برنامهنویس وب حرفهای شوید؟ در هر صورت، PHP اولین ایستگاه شما در این سفر هیجانانگیز خواهد بود. PHP یکی از محبوبترین زبانهای برنامهنویسی برای ساخت وبسایتهای پویا و تعاملی است.
در این مقاله، قصد داریم شما را با مفاهیم پایه PHP آشنا کنیم تا بتوانید اولین قدمهای خود را در دنیای برنامهنویسی وب بردارید. پس با زنون همراه باشید!
مفاهیم پایه PHP: یک ماجراجویی جذاب
1. متغیرها: جعبههای جادویی برای نگهداری دادهها
تصور کنید متغیرها جعبههایی هستند که میتوانید هر چیزی را در آنها قرار دهید. در PHP، از این جعبهها برای نگهداری اطلاعات مانند نام، سن، قیمت و … استفاده میکنیم.
$name = "زنون";
$age = 27;
2. انواع داده: تنوع دادهها در PHP
در دنیای واقعی، با انواع مختلف داده روبرو هستیم، مثل اعداد، حروف و عبارات. PHP هم برای هر نوع داده، یک نوع خاص تعریف کرده است تا بتوانید با آنها کار کنید.
$name ="xe-non.ir"; //رشته
$year= 1403; // عدد صحیح
$price = 143.99; // عدد اعشاری
$flag= true; // بولین
$colors = ["قرمز", "مشکی", "زرد"]; // آرایه
3. عملگرها: ابزارهایی برای انجام محاسبات در PHP
عملگرها مانند ابزارهایی هستند که برای انجام عملیات روی دادهها استفاده میشوند. مثلاً برای جمع کردن دو عدد، از عملگر جمع (+) استفاده میکنیم.
$x = 15;
$y = 3;
$sum = $x + $y; // جمع
4. شرطها: تصمیمگیری هوشمندانه
با استفاده از شرطها، میتوانیم به برنامه خود بگوییم که بر اساس شرایط مختلف، چه کاری انجام دهد. مثلاً اگر کاربر کمتر از 10 سال بود، پیام خوش آمدگویی خاصی نمایش دهیم.
if ($age <= 10)
{
echo "سلام فندوق کوچولو";
}
5. حلقهها: تکرار کارها به صورت خودکار
تکرار یک کار تکراری خستهکننده است! خوشبختانه، با استفاده از حلقهها میتوانیم به کامپیوتر بگوییم که یک کار را چندین بار تکرار کند.
for ($i = 0; $i < 5; $i++) {
echo "شماره: " . $i . "<br>";
}
یک ماشین حساب ساده
فرض کنید میخواهیم یک ماشین حساب ساده با استفاده از PHP بسازیم. برای این کار، از متغیرها برای نگهداری اعداد، از عملگرها برای انجام محاسبات و از شرطها برای نمایش نتیجه استفاده میکنیم.
$num_1 = 18;
$num_2 = 50;
$sum = $num_1 + $num_2;
if( $sum%2==0)
echo "نتیجه جمع دو عدد زوج است" ;
else
echo "نتیجه جمع دو عدد فرد است" ;
جمعبندی
در این مقاله، به صورت مختصر و مفید با مفاهیم پایه PHP آشنا شدیم. یادگیری این مفاهیم، اولین قدم برای ساخت وبسایتهای پویا و تعاملی است.
مقاله بعدی قدم اول در دنیای لاراول را از دست ندهید. لطفا نظرات خود را در مورد این مقاله بنویسید.
با زنــــــxenonــــــون همراه باشید تا دنیای جذاب برنامهنویسی وب را کشف کنیم.
دیدگاهتان را بنویسید